编程机械手加剪刀的过程涉及多个步骤,以下是一个详细的指南:
了解设备和选择编程语言
熟悉机械手和剪刀的工作原理、功能和限制。
选择适合的编程语言,如C++、Python或专用机器人编程语言。
编写控制逻辑
确定机械手的起始点和终止点,以及剪刀的起始位置和剪切位置。
编写程序控制机械手的五个轴,使其移动到正确的位置。
编写程序控制机械手的夹爪,使其夹住剪刀。
编写程序控制剪刀进行剪切。
编写程序控制机械手的夹爪,使其松开剪刀。
实现联动控制
将机械手代码和剪刀代码合并为一个程序,确保两者能够联动工作。
设置变量来控制剪刀的动作,例如,当机械手到达指定位置时,启动剪切功能。
调试和优化
在设备上进行实际测试,调试代码以确保机械手和剪刀按预期工作。
根据测试结果进行优化,提高精度和效率。
考虑安全和应急措施
在编程过程中,充分考虑发生事故时的应急处理措施,确保操作的安全性。
参考文档和指南
参考设备制造商提供的文档和指南,以确保正确和安全地进行编程。
示例代码(伪代码)
```python
初始化变量
cut = 0
机械手移动到起始位置
move_to_start_position()
等待机械手到达指定位置
wait_for_position()
设置剪刀动作变量
cut = 1
循环检测剪刀动作变量
while cut == 1:
执行剪刀剪切动作
perform_cut()
检查是否需要停止剪切
if should_stop_cut():
cut = 0
```
注意事项
安全性:确保编程过程中考虑到所有可能的安全风险,并采取相应的预防措施。
效率:优化代码以提高机械手和剪刀的工作效率。
准确性:确保机械手能够准确地在指定位置执行剪切动作。
通过以上步骤和注意事项,可以实现机械手和剪刀的自动化剪切操作。